*{box-sizing:border-box}.estimate-tagline{color:#0f2747;font-size:18px;font-weight:700;margin-bottom:10px}.next-steps-box .panel-info-wrapper{margin:0;padding:0}.estimate-summary{color:#1f2d3d;font-size:20px;line-height:1.7;margin:0 auto 12px}.estimate-note{color:#1f2d3d;font-size:16px;margin:auto;max-width:780px}.start-over-btn{align-items:center;background:#fff;border:1px solid #00b0f0;border-radius:999px;color:#00b0f0;display:inline-flex;font-size:15px;font-weight:700;justify-content:center;margin:35px auto 0;max-width:200px;padding:10px 22px;text-decoration:none}.start-over-btn:hover{background:#92d050;border-color:#00b0f0;color:#000;transform:translateY(-2px)}next-steps-box .panel-info-wrapper{margin-bottom:0;padding-bottom:0}.hsfc-Step__Content{padding-bottom:10px!important;text-align:left}body{margin:0;padding:0}.panel-info-wrapper,body{font-family:Arial,sans-serif}.panel-info-wrapper{color:#1f2d3d;margin:70px auto;max-width:1180px;padding:20px}.info-card{background:#fff;border-radius:22px;box-shadow:0 18px 50px rgba(15,39,71,.08);margin-bottom:45px;overflow:hidden;padding:55px;position:relative}.info-card:before{background:#0f2747;content:"";height:6px;left:0;position:absolute;top:0;width:100%}.bottom-grid{display:grid;gap:40px;grid-template-columns:repeat(2,minmax(280px,1fr));margin:30px auto;max-width:900px}.bottom-grid ul{list-style:none;margin:0;padding:0}#hubspotFormWrapper{background:#fff;border-radius:22px;box-shadow:0 15px 40px rgba(15,39,71,.08);margin-top:40px;padding:35px}.warning-card{background:linear-gradient(180deg,#fffaf0,#fff)}.warning-card:before{background:#f4b400}.danger-card{background:linear-gradient(180deg,#fff5f5,#fff)}.danger-card:before{background:#e53935}.cta-card{background:linear-gradient(180deg,#f3f8ff,#fff)}.cta-card:before{background:#92d050}.info-card h2{color:#0f2747;font-size:36px;font-weight:800;letter-spacing:-.5px;line-height:1.2;margin-bottom:30px;text-align:center}.info-card p{color:#425466;font-size:19px;line-height:1.9;margin:0 auto 18px;max-width:900px;text-align:left}.highlight-line{background:rgba(146,208,80,.12);border-left:4px solid #92d050;border-radius:10px;color:#0f2747!important;display:block;font-size:22px!important;font-weight:700;margin:28px auto!important;padding:18px 22px}.cost-grid{display:grid;gap:40px;grid-template-columns:repeat(2,minmax(280px,1fr));margin:35px auto;max-width:900px}.benefit-list,.cost-grid ul,.danger-list{list-style:none;margin:0;padding:0}.benefit-list li,.cost-grid li,.danger-list li{color:#1f2d3d;font-size:18px;line-height:1.8;margin-bottom:16px;padding-left:34px;position:relative;text-align:left}.benefit-list li:before,.cost-grid li:before{color:#92d050;content:"✓";font-size:20px;font-weight:700;left:0;position:absolute;top:1px}.danger-list li:before{color:#e53935;content:"✕";font-size:18px;font-weight:700;left:0;position:absolute;top:1px}.tip-text{color:#0f2747!important;font-size:22px!important;font-weight:700;margin-top:35px!important}.mistake-text,.tip-text{text-align:center!important}.mistake-text{color:#b71c1c!important;font-size:28px!important;font-weight:800;margin-bottom:28px!important}.goal-text{color:#0f2747!important;font-size:24px!important;margin-top:30px!important;text-align:center!important}.subheading{margin-bottom:25px!important}.closing-line,.subheading{color:#0f2747!important;font-size:24px!important;font-weight:800;text-align:center!important}.closing-line{border-top:1px solid rgba(15,39,71,.08);margin-top:35px!important;padding-top:18px}#estimator{margin:0 auto;max-width:950px;padding:40px 20px;text-align:center;width:100%}.next-steps-box p{max-width:1250px}div#hubspotFormWrapper{margin:auto;max-width:650px}div#hubspotFormWrapper label,form#a3a831cd-338f-4226-be8b-40ef02426e2e-cc702ddf-39a9-4105-9fef-924297c21f23{text-align:left}#resultDesc,#resultTitle{max-width:1250px!important;text-align:center}.step{display:none;width:100%}.step.active{display:block}h3{color:#0f2747;font-size:42px;line-height:1.3;margin-bottom:16px}p{color:#4f5b67;font-size:20px;line-height:1.7;margin:0 auto 30px;max-width:850px}p#resultDesc{color:#000;font-size:17px;margin-bottom:30px}.next-steps-box p{color:#000;font-size:16px;margin-bottom:10px}button{background:#f3f5f7;border:none;border-radius:10px;color:#0f2747;cursor:pointer;display:block;font-size:20px;line-height:1.4;margin:12px auto;max-width:650px;padding:20px 24px;text-align:center;transition:all .25s ease;width:100%}button:hover{background:#92d050;color:#fff;transform:translateY(-2px)}button:active{transform:scale(.98)}#resultTitle{color:#0f2747;display:block!important;font-size:45px;line-height:1.3;margin:0 auto 20px;white-space:normal!important;width:100%;word-break:keep-all}#resultDesc,#resultTitle{max-width:900px;text-align:center}#resultDesc{color:#4f5b67;font-size:20px;line-height:1.7;margin:0 auto}.cta-btn{background:#92d050;border-radius:10px;color:#fff;display:inline-block;font-size:16px;font-weight:700;margin-top:10px;padding:10px 20px;text-decoration:none;transition:all .25s ease}.cta-btn:hover{background:#ccc;border:1px solid #00b0f0;color:#000;transform:translateY(-2px)}.start-over-btn{color:#0f2747;cursor:pointer;display:block;font-size:16px;font-weight:600;margin-top:18px;transition:all .25s ease}@media (min-width:1440px){#estimator{max-width:1100px}h3{font-size:40px}#resultDesc,button,p{font-size:20px}#resultTitle{font-size:45px}}@media (max-width:1200px){h3{font-size:32px}#resultDesc,button,p{font-size:20px}#resultTitle{font-size:46px}}@media (max-width:992px){.bottom-grid{gap:0;grid-template-columns:1fr}.info-card{padding:38px 28px}.info-card h2{font-size:34px}.benefit-list li,.cost-grid li,.danger-list li,.info-card p{font-size:17px}.cost-grid{gap:0;grid-template-columns:1fr}.mistake-text{font-size:24px!important}#estimator{padding:30px 18px}h3{font-size:28px}#resultDesc,button,p{font-size:19px}button{padding:18px}#resultTitle{font-size:40px}.cta-btn{font-size:20px;padding:16px 30px}}@media (max-width:768px){.hsfc-Step__Content{padding:0!important}.bottom-grid,.cost-grid{display:block}#hubspotFormWrapper{border-radius:18px;padding:24px 18px}.panel-info-wrapper{margin:40px auto;padding:14px}.info-card{border-radius:18px;padding:30px 20px}.info-card h2{font-size:28px;text-align:left}.info-card p{font-size:16px;line-height:1.75;text-align:left}.closing-line,.goal-text,.highlight-line,.tip-text{font-size:19px!important;text-align:left!important}.mistake-text{font-size:22px!important}.start-over-btn{font-size:15px;margin-top:16px}#estimator{padding:25px 16px}h3{font-size:28px}p{line-height:1.6;margin-bottom:20px}button,p{font-size:17px}button{margin:10px auto;padding:16px}#resultTitle{font-size:34px;line-height:1.35}#resultDesc{font-size:17px}.cta-btn{display:block;font-size:18px;margin:10px auto 0;max-width:320px;padding:16px;width:100%}}@media (max-width:480px){.info-card{border-radius:16px;padding:24px 16px}.info-card h2{font-size:24px;margin-bottom:0}.benefit-list li,.cost-grid li,.danger-list li,.info-card p{font-size:15px!important;margin-left:0!important;margin-top:10px;text-align:left!important}.highlight-line{padding:14px 16px}#estimator{padding:20px 14px}h3{font-size:20px}button,p{font-size:16px}button{border-radius:8px;padding:15px 14px}#resultTitle{font-size:28px}#resultDesc{font-size:16px}.cta-btn{border-radius:8px;font-size:17px;padding:14px}}@media (max-width:360px){h3{font-size:22px}#resultDesc,button,p{font-size:15px}#resultTitle{font-size:24px}}